Abstract
The utility model provides a division impedance decompression silencer, comprising a cylinder body with a tail pipe. The inner of one port of the cylinder body is provided with a small hole pipe, the inner of the cylinder body is provided with a piece of partition board, and the small hole pipe passes through a central hole on the partition board. One end in the cylinder body near the tail pipe is provided with four damping plates, a decompression expansion chamber is formed between two damping plates, and the four damping plates form three decompression expansion chambers. The damping plates are composed of a damping tube partition board having the same diameter with the inner diameter of the cylinder body and a damping tube arranged on the damping tube partition board.
Description
The utility model relates to a kind of automotive muffler.
The blast wave pressure of automobile engine to exhaust noise and its production is big public hazards of urban environment, the serious harm health.The blast wave pressure that reduces automobile engine to exhaust noise and its generation is that people want the problem that solves always.Existing silencing apparatus generally adopts expansion chamber and resonant chamber to form, and generally about 40-60mm, the inner connecting tube bore is too big in the inner connecting tube aperture of its formation expansion chamber, is difficult to reach reduce the blast wave pressure, reduces anti noise.
The purpose of this utility model provides a kind of reduction blast wave pressure, reduces the flow deviding type impedance step-down silencing apparatus of noise.
Technical solution of the present utility model is such: flow deviding type impedance step-down silencing apparatus comprises a cylindrical shell that has tail pipe, be provided with an aperture pipe in the port of body, be provided with a dividing plate in the cylindrical shell, the aperture pipe passes the center hole on the dividing plate, has been covered with aperture on the port of cylindrical shell and the aperture pipe between the dividing plate.That end by tail pipe in cylindrical shell is provided with four damping plates, and four damping plate intervals each other are not less than 100mm, forms a decompressional expansion chamber between two damping plates, and four damping plates form three decompressional expansion chambers.
The flow deviding type impedance step-down silencing apparatus that uses the utility model to provide on automobile, after noise, the blast of engine exhaust generation entered silencing apparatus, through shunting in a large number, repeatedly damping was interfered mutually, has reached good step-down and noise elimination effect.And it is little to have exhaust resistance damage, economic fuel-economizing, effects such as cleaning of off-gas.

Now in conjunction with the accompanying drawings the utility model is made detailed description:
The flow deviding type impedance step-down silencing apparatus that the utility model provides comprises a cylindrical shell 2 that has tail pipe 5, and the length ratio of the diameter of cylindrical shell 2 and cylindrical shell 2 is 1: 3-4, the internal diameter of tail pipe 5 is 1 with the ratio of the internal diameter of cylindrical shell 2: 3-4.Be provided with an aperture pipe 1 in the port of cylindrical shell 2, be provided with a dividing plate 3 in cylindrical shell 2, aperture pipe 1 passes the center hole on the dividing plate 3, has been covered with aperture on the port of cylindrical shell 2 and the aperture pipe 1 between the dividing plate 3.The length ratio of the length of aperture pipe 1 and cylindrical shell 2 is 1: 2-3, the internal diameter of aperture pipe is 1 with the ratio of the internal diameter of cylindrical shell 2: 2-3.The interval that is provided with between 4, four damping plates 4 of four damping plates by that end of tail pipe 5 in cylindrical shell 2 is not less than 100mm, forms 8, four damping plates 4 in a decompressional expansion chamber between two damping plates 4 and has formed three decompressional expansion chambers 8.Damping plate 4 is made up of the same big damp tube dividing plate 6 with cylindrical shell 2 internal diameters of a diameter and the damp tube 7 that is installed on the damp tube dividing plate 6, and damp tube 7 is distributed on damping every pulling on 6, is inserted in the mounting hole on the damp tube dividing plate 6.The length of damp tube 7 is not less than 60mm, and the aperture of damp tube 7 is 4-6mm, and the aperture sum of the damp tube 7 on every damping tube sheet 4 should equal the aperture of exhaust valve seat for automobile engine.
